[英]git commit and pull request separate branches
我從master克隆了一個存儲庫,並對幾個文件進行了一些更改。 我被要求提交並為我所做的每組更改創建一個拉取請求。 例如,樣式更改應進入一個分支並在那里提交並提出請求。 另一個分支應該是對JS文件所做的更改,並且必須具有自己的拉取請求和分支。
我做了git checkout -b [branchName]
然后git add
只git add
相關文件,然后git commit
,最后git push --set-upstream origin [branchName]
。 當我這樣做3次時,它創建了3個獨立的分支,但它們都共享相同的提交和請求請求。
如何提交相關的更改和文件並將其推送到自己的分支,以便它們具有自己的提交歷史記錄和請求請求?
這里有兩個選項:
branch1
, branch2
, branch3
git checkout branch1
,進行更改,進行git add
然后進行git commit
branch1
創建拉取請求 branch2
(對branch3
進行相同branch3
) 第二個選擇如下。 假設您是從master
開始的。
checkout -b
創建branch1
git add
,執行git commit
git checkout master
(所以可以回溯歷史) branch2
(與branch3
相同)
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.